What Is a Uganda Mangabey Safari Experience?
A mangabey-focused safari is any itinerary where guided forest walks at endemic sites anchor the primate component — not savannah game drives or wetland shoebill canoe trips alone. Most travellers encounter Uganda mangabeys as part of broader primate weeks combining Mabira or Kibale with chimpanzees, gorilla trekking, and community forest tourism. The endemic monkey adds biogeographic rarity — a species found nowhere else on Earth.
Core Safari Activities
Guided Forest Walks at Mabira
Half-day or full-day walks with community or NFA-affiliated guides through Mabira's moist semi-deciduous forest. Griffin Falls trails and interior loops deliver primate, bird, and butterfly diversity. Ideal for Kampala–Jinja transfers or dedicated central Uganda birding/primate days.
Kibale Chimpanzee Trekking Plus Forest Time
Morning chimp permits at Kanyanchu anchor western itineraries. Uganda mangabeys may appear en route; dedicated afternoon forest walks improve endemic focus. Lodge trails and UWA nature walks add second chances without extra great-ape permits.
Bugoma Forest Ecotourism
Emerging walks near Hoima pair mangabeys with chimpanzee habitat and Albertine Rift approaches. Strong for travellers avoiding peak Kibale permit competition while supporting under-visited forest conservation.
Bigodi Wetland Complement
Afternoon Bigodi Wetland Sanctuary boardwalks add red colobus and grey-cheeked mangabeys — related but distinct from Uganda mangabeys. Classic Kibale pairing spreads primate diversity across forest and swamp edges.

Central Uganda Corridor Stops
Mabira fits naturally between Entebbe/Kampala and Jinja adventure tourism — shoebill mornings at Mabamba, forest midday at Mabira, Nile afternoon at source. Efficient endemic primate insertion without detouring west.
Western Uganda Primate Weeks
Kibale-centred weeks are the default for chimpanzee-focused travellers. Insist on forest walk time beyond the chimp hour if Uganda mangabeys are a priority — operators can schedule lodge trails or nature walks on non-chimp mornings.
What Is Not Included
There is no Uganda mangabey trekking permit analogous to gorilla or chimp permits. Costs cover park or forest entry, guiding fees, and transport. Encounter rates are wild-forest probabilities, not habituated guarantees — set expectations accordingly.
Packing and Fitness
Forest walks require moderate fitness — uneven ground, mud in wet season, and two to four hours on foot typical. The same kit serves chimp trekking: sturdy boots, rain layer, repellent, binoculars. See behaviour and best time pages for seasonal detail.
Conservation-Linked Travel
Choosing Mabira community guides and paying official Kibale fees links tourism directly to forest protection — central to endangered endemic survival. Read conservation context before you travel; informed visitors advocate louder for forest retention.
